**CI: Gravemeter GPU profiler hangs on shared runners**

Gravemeter's memory-profiling stage deadlocks when two jobs share a GPU node. Cause: exclusive device lock never released on SIGTERM. Mitigation this week: pin profiling jobs to the solo pool. Proper fix (lock timeout) lands next sprint. For the sync: hangs dropped from nine to zero after pinning. Affected pipeline run is identified by the token below.

pipeline stamp: htk9_ce63042d9

Subject: DR drill — Grindlace job queue replacement

Security review requested. Wednesday's disaster-recovery drill exercises the cutover from our homegrown Grindlace queue to the Velverine broker. Scope: failover of the broker cluster, replay of in-flight jobs, and verification that no payloads land in plaintext during transit. Audit logs will be captured for your review. Legacy Grindlace stays read-only throughout; rollback window is two hours. Access to the drill's sealed evidence bundle requires the recovery passphrase below.

strongbox words: gilok-druion-briath-wendor-briion-prawyn-fenion-oliir-casdor-holius-briius-gilath-gilael-pelys

Minutes — Management Meeting, Dunmore Branch Network

Attendees: R. Ashfeld (chair), L. Okonjo, P. Verity.

Churn in the Greyhaven pilot reached 12% against an 8% target. Analysis attributes losses mainly to delayed installations. Agreed actions: branches to confirm install dates within 48 hours of sign-up; weekly churn reporting to head office begins Monday. Branch managers are asked to treat the following planning note as strictly confidential.

board note of kageg-bahof: The renewal with Holwynax Holdings closes at $2 million a year, 5 percent below the last contract. Project Ulaath slips by two quarters because of the supplier delay.

Subject: DR drill wrap-up — SnackRoute planner

Hey future maintainers — we ran the annual disaster-recovery drill for the SnackRoute vending restock planner today. Restore from the Quillton replica took 14 minutes, within target. One snag: the config bundle is encrypted and nobody remembered where the passphrase lived. Fixing that now by recording it right here.

unlock words, yawig-kagef: gordor-holvan-ulaael-pramir-ulaiel-tamdor